AES coprocessor system and AES structure in wireless sensor network node application

A wireless sensor and network node technology, applied in transmission systems, digital transmission systems, encryption devices with shift registers/memory, etc. Data, the effect of reducing design area and power consumption

Inactive Publication Date: 2009-11-25
PEKING UNIV SHENZHEN GRADUATE SCHOOL
View PDF0 Cites 19 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] In order to overcome the shortcomings of excessive hardware cost and power consumption in most existing AES coprocessor designs, which are not suitable for integration in wireless network nodes, the present invention proposes a design based on a system-level framework based on multiplexing technology method

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• AES coprocessor system and AES structure in wireless sensor network node application
  • AES coprocessor system and AES structure in wireless sensor network node application
  • AES coprocessor system and AES structure in wireless sensor network node application

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022] The invention supports a half-duplex working mode, and can perform encryption / decryption operations separately, and the same module only needs to perform one operation of encryption / decryption at the same time. Only one encrypt signal is needed to distinguish. The encrypt signal controls the key selection of the s-box, mixcolumn and key register for encryption and decryption multiplexing, and whether the cycle key performs inv-mixcolumn operation, etc. In this way, the same module can realize both the encryption operation and the decryption operation. For wireless sensor networks with low speed requirements, this is also beneficial to reduce the area.

[0023] The data interface of the module is 32 bits, and the input and output adopt independent interfaces. The input and output of plaintext / ciphertext are both 32 bits, which are serially input and output in four cycles. While outputting the cipher / plaintext after encryption / decryption, the next set of ciphertext / ciph...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

In order to overcome the defects of overlarge hardware cost and power consumption and unsuitable integration in a wireless sensor network node in the design of a plurality of prior AES coprocessors, the invention provides a module reuse method in AES coprocessors apply for wireless sensor network node. The method mainly utilizes the multiplexing technology and process optimization to finish an encrypting and decrypting function by fewest submodules. The AES structure process adopts multiplexing ways of internal turn resource share, each high level module multiplexing submodules and external turn single cycle and can encrypts / decrypts. The invention can reduce application cost and hardware expenditure and effectively lower power consumption on the basis of ensuring reliable data, and the system throughput rate also conforms to the requirement of a wireless sensor network and is suitable for using VLSI hardware. In the special application of the wireless sensor network node, an AES encrypting and decrypting coprocessor in the structure can be closer to practical application as supplying the reliable data.

Description

Technical field [0001] The invention relates to an encryption and decryption algorithm, especially a design method and system of an AES coprocessor in a low-cost and low-power consumption specific environment of a wireless sensor network node. Background technique [0002] In recent years, due to the wide application prospects, the research of wireless networked smart sensors has attracted great attention from all parties, and has become a research hotspot, but there are many factors to be considered or problems to be studied. Security is an important aspect of this. Nowadays, wireless networks are widely used, but wireless networks lack sufficient security due to their special transmission methods, and the information transmitted on the network will be threatened by illegal eavesdropping, tampering and destruction at any time. Using data encryption technology to encrypt information can greatly improve the security of wireless networks. With the continuous development of W...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L9/06H04L9/28H04L12/28
CPCY02B60/50
Inventor 李玉文张兴蒋安平曹健
Owner PEKING UNIV SHENZHEN GRADUATE SCHOOL
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products